Mercedes-Benz launches an E-Class All Terrain Estate

Mercedes-Benz launches an E-Class All Terrain Estate Mercedes-Benz, launched its most versatile E-Class, the all new E-Class All-Terrain. The All-Terrain comes equipped with a four-cylinder diesel engine that generates 194 hp of power and 4MATIC(all-wheel drive). A special model-specific feature, All-Terrain transmission mode, is inspired from the Mercedes-Benz GLE range which offers off-road drive settings. Ferrari launches its beautiful Portofino convertible

Ferrari launches its beautiful Portofino convertible Ferrari has officially launched the Portofino, its 2+2 GT convertible starting at INR 3.5 crore (ex-showroom, India). The Portofino is named after a quaint Italian village by the same name. The Portofino is the successor to the Ferrari California T, which was a 2-seat convertible. The Portofino, however, has…
